因为python 的requests 不能使用抓http2 的报文。所以看了一些httpx的使用。但是发现httpx 不能自动解压,text打印出来的都是乱码。一开始以为是编码格式的bug ,但是使用chardet 确认了确实是utf-8.然后怀疑是压缩的问题。先去官网搜了一些文档
文档说会自动帮忙解压。然后只能看看报文头的压缩关键字了
,"Accept-Encoding":"gzip, deflate ,br"
经过我的测试发现只要把,br 删了 httpx 就能自动解压了。暂时不太清楚为啥。可能是bug。或者是新标准的问题,暂时也没深入研究http2,先记录下来把。